Syllabus for Operating System

Semester 4 · SY BE AI and DS · NEP 2020

Module Fundamentals of Operating System 03 hours

  • Fundamentals of Operating System Introduction of Operating Systems: System Boot, Objectives of Operating System Functions of Operating System, Operating System Structure and Operations, Operating System Services, Multiprogramming, Multitasking, Multithreading, Types of Operating System, Types of System Calls.
  • Self-learning Topics: Study of various Operating System Architecture like IoT, Android.
  • Process Management Basic Concepts of Process: Process State Transition Model, Operations, Process Control Block, Context Switching; Introduction to Threads, Types of Threads, Thread Models, Basic Concepts of Scheduling, Types of Schedulers, Type of scheduling algorithms: Preemptive and non preemptive (FCFS, SJF, Priority and Round Robin) Self-learning Topics: Real-time Scheduling algorithms and applications.
  • Process Synchronization and Deadlock Management Basic Concepts of Inter-process Communication and Synchronization, Race Condition, Critical Section Problem ,Peterson's Solution, Process Synchronization, Hardware and Semaphores, Producer Consumer Problem. Deadlocks Management: System Model, Deadlock Characterization, Deadlock Prevention, Deadlock Avoidance: Bankers algorithm, Deadlock Detection and Recovery. Self-learning Topics: Study a real time case study for Deadlock detection and recovery. Overview of security mechanism in OS.
  • Memory Management Basic Concepts of Memory Management: Swapping, Memory Allocation strategy, Paging, Structure of Page Table, Segmentation, TLB. Basic Concepts of Virtual Memory, Demand Paging, Copy-on Write, Page Replacement Algorithms, Thrashing. Self-learning Topics: Memory Management of IoT, Android Operating System.
  • File and IO Management File Management: Basic Concepts of File System, File Access Methods, Directory Structure, File-System implementation, Allocation Methods, Overview of Mass-Storage Structure, I/O devices, Organization of the I/O Function, Disk Organization, I/O Management and Disk Scheduling: FCFS, SSTF, SCAN, C-SCAN, LOOK, C-LOOK. Self-learning Topics: File System for Linux and Windows, Features of I/O facility for different OS.
  • Special-purpose Operating Systems Open-source and Proprietary Operating System, Fundamentals of Distributed Operating System, Network Operating System, Architecture and functions: Cloud Operating System, Real-Time Operating System, Mobile Operating System. Self-learning Topics: Case Study on any one Special-purpose Operating Systems.

Text Books

  • 1 A. Silberschatz, P. Galvin, G. Gagne, Operating System Concepts, 10th ed., Wiley, 2018.
  • 2 W. Stallings, Operating Systems: Internal and Design Principles, 9th ed., Pearson, 2018.
  • 3 A. Tanenbaum, Modern Operating Systems, Pearson, 4th ed., 2015.

Reference Books

  • 1 Achyut Godbole and Atul Kahate, Operating Systems, McGraw Hill Education, 3rdEdition
  • 2 N. Chauhan, Principles of Operating Systems, 1st ed., Oxford University Press, 2014.
  • 3 A. Tanenbaum and A. Woodhull, Operating System Design and Implementation, 3rd ed., Pearson.
  • 4 R. Arpaci-Dusseau and A. Arpaci-Dusseau, Operating Systems: Three Easy Pieces, CreateSpace Independent Publishing Platform, 1st ed., 2018.
